St. Michael’s Prep?

Located in the hills of southwest Austin, Texas, St. Michael’s Catholic Preparatory School is an outstanding co‑educational independent Catholic school serving students from Pre‑Kindergarten through 12th grade in Austin, Texas. The Lower School is comprised of PreK 3‑4th grades, the Middle School houses grades 5‑8, and the Upper School contains grades 9‑12. We are distinguished by our Catholic tradition, a welcoming and diverse community, excellent academic programs and a variety of extracurricular activities.

Additionally, we are a technology‑rich school. Thus teachers and staff are expected to demonstrate meaningful skill with technology and an enthusiasm for technological growth in order to create authentic learning experiences for their students. Teachers hael’s Prep further serve as role models that inspire students to critically think, reflect, explore and apply their faith concretely to their lives. We are one community, on two campuses, with three divisions, united in our commitment to put students first as we educate them in mind, body, and spirit.

Summary of Position

We are thrilled to announce that St. Michael’s Prep is adding a second section of Pre‑K3—a milestone that reflects both the exceptional strength of our early childhood program and our commitment to the future of our school community.

This expansion is a deliberate and strategic decision shaped by several years of research, analysis, and thoughtful planning. Known for its joyful learning environment, nurturing teachers, and commitment to whole‑child development, St. Michael’s Prep is seeking a qualified and passionate Early Childhood (Pre‑K
3) Teacher with knowledge of Reggio Emilia and Montessori philosophies along with a deep understanding of constructivism and social‑emotional learning in order to create a joyful environment where children move from “me” to “we.” Our Pre‑K 3 program explores the cultural identities and unique profiles of our students in order to build self and social awareness, educating children who will become empathetic and virtuous leaders who positively impact the world.

This is a 10‑month, full‑time position with a competitive salary and benefits that will begin in August 2026.

Ideal Candidates

The ideal candidate is passionate about working with young children, has a foundational understanding of child development, and possesses a professional and nurturing demeanor. Candidates must be skilled in delivering innovative and creative, cross‑curricular instruction that is rooted in inquiry and discovery. Meaningful parent partnerships are central to student success. Parents look to educators to help guide and explore the stages of development and the rapid growth that accompanies early childhood.

As such, strong communication skills are required, as frequent parent communication is expected. A collaborative and growth mindset is essential as well.
